NZ man dies protecting family in South Africa

49-year-old Eugene Robbemond from Whanganu tragically lost his life during a violent robbery in Cape Town, South Africa.

Visiting his parents, Robbemond intervened as a group of armed men accosted them outside their home after following them from a bank. In an act of bravery, he reportedly threw a sledgehammer at the attackers’ getaway car, prompting them to fatally shoot him.

He died in his father’s arms on the roadside.

The devastating incident has left his family and friends heartbroken, including his 16-year-old son and girlfriend in New Zealand.

Robbemond, a passionate engineer and beloved member of the Superstocks Teams Racing community, has been remembered as a kind-hearted and generous soul.

Tributes poured in from friends and racing teammates who admired his sense of humour, dedication, and compassion.

South African authorities have located the attackers’ vehicle. The manhunt continues.
